Schwa sound - Schwa is a short neutral vowel sound and, like all other vowels, its precise quality varies depending on the adjacent consonants . While in Received Pronunciation schwa only occurs in unstressed syllables, in General American English, it may be analyzed that schwa occurs in both stressed and unstressed syllables. [5]

English is a stress-timed language in which multisyllabic words include primary and secondary-stressed syllables andVowel Reduction 101. The difference between /ə/ and /ʌ/, at a fundamental level, is that /ə/ is a reduced vowel, whereas /ʌ/ is a full vowel. Vowel reduction is a phenomenon that happens around the world, according to different rules for each language, but the basic idea is that we simply don’t need to fully articulate which aren’t ... Ability, uh. The schwa goes with the syllabic consonants L, M, N, and R. That means when you have a syllable with a schwa followed by one of these consonants, you don’t need to make the schwa. It gets absorbed by the next sound. For example, the word ‘father’: th-rr, th-rr. Schwa can be represented in writing by all five vowels, and by a number of digraphs and trigraphs such as ‘er’, ‘ou ...The shwa (or schwa) sound is the most common vowel in English. Its representation in the IPA is /ə/, which is a rotated lowercase "e" (the most common vowel letter in written English). It's the vowel in English /bət/ but, and the second vowel in batter, battle, hammock, gotta, and Hannah. It's what happens to unstressed vowels in English ....
